.template-collection .product-collection__image .rimage{padding-top:55%!important}.buttons-row{max-width:340px}.btn.btn--invert:hover,.btn.btn--invert.active-medify{background-color:var(--button2-h-bg);border-color:var(--button2-h-bd);color:var(--button2-h-c)}.bundles-cta__link{color:#0170b7!important;font-weight:700;font-size:14px;line-height:28px;letter-spacing:4px;margin-bottom:30px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.product-collection h4{font-size:30px}.custom-theme .home-builder{overflow:visible!important}.custom-theme .cta-join__img:after{content:"";width:136px;height:136px;background:#0170b7;display:block;border-radius:50%;position:absolute;bottom:-10%;left:-15%;z-index:-1}.custom-theme .cta-join__img:before{content:"";width:40px;height:40px;display:block;border:3px solid #0170b7;border-radius:50%;position:absolute;top:10%;z-index:1;right:-2%}.align-content-right .promobox__content{margin-left:auto}.bundles-cta h2{font-size:34px;margin-bottom:20px!important;font-weight:500;letter-spacing:0}.bundles-cta{line-height:1.7em}.bundles-cta h3{font-size:30px;font-weight:500;line-height:1.2em;margin-top:15px;margin-bottom:10px}[data-section-type=carousel-products] .container{max-width:1400px}.collection-info-line h2.h4.information-line-title{font-size:34px;line-height:1.4em;font-weight:500;color:#0170b7;margin-bottom:0!important}.information-line--type-2 .information-line__title{color:#192f58}@media (min-width: 992px){.custom-theme .cta-join__img--alt-1:after{bottom:41%;left:-30%;width:375px;height:375px}.custom-theme .cta-join__img:before{width:86px;height:86px;top:7%;right:-4%}}@media (min-width: 991px){.custom-theme .bundles-cta__link{-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start}}@media (min-width: 767px){product-item.product-collection{height:100%}product-item.product-collection .swiper-wrapper .product-collection__wrapper{height:calc(100% - 30px);padding-bottom:100px;position:relative}product-item.product-collection .swiper-wrapper .product-collection__wrapper .collection_action{position:absolute;bottom:35px}}@media (max-width: 767px){.product-collection__wrapper form.d-flex{flex-direction:row!important}.collection-grid-centered-xs .product-collection__image{max-width:40%;margin-left:auto;margin-right:auto;display:flex;align-items:center}.collection-grid-centered-xs .product-collection__image>a{width:100%}.collection-grid-centered-xs .product-collection__image{max-width:40%}.product-collection .product-collection__content{padding-top:30px!important;width:60%;padding-bottom:30px!important}.template-collection .product-collection__image .rimage{padding-top:100%!important}.collection-grid-centered-xs .product-collection__content{align-items:flex-start!important;text-align:left}.product-collection .js-product-button-add-to-cart{width:auto;min-width:auto;font-size:10px;min-height:40px!important;letter-spacing:1px!important}.product-collection .product-collection__content p{font-size:11px;line-height:1.7em;margin-bottom:10px}div#first-option-row{flex-wrap:wrap}.collection-filters .collections__body{padding-bottom:0!important}.collection-grid-section .container>.mb-40{margin-bottom:10px!important}.product-collection h4,.bundles-cta h2{font-size:18px;line-height:1.3em}.bundles-cta h2{margin-bottom:15px!important}.bundles-cta h3{font-size:19px}.mx-20.bundles-cta__product{margin:0 15px!important}.list-view-item__price-column .btn{font-size:12px!important}.bundles-cta__link{letter-spacing:0}.collection-info-line h2.h4.information-line-title{font-size:18px}.product-collection__wrapper:hover{-webkit-box-shadow:none;box-shadow:none}.carousel__products .product-collection__image{display:flex;align-items:center;width:40%!important}.carousel__products .product-collection__image>a{width:100%}}
/*# sourceMappingURL=/cdn/shop/t/283/assets/purifier-collections.css.map */
